How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90211?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
90211 Studio Apartments | $2,034 | $1,690 | $3,095 |
90211 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,506 | $1,590 | $10,000+ |
90211 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,163 | $2,295 | $10,500 |
90211 3 Bedroom Apartments | $11,331 | $3,535 | $29,000 |
90211 4 Bedroom Apartments | $9,523 | $3,920 | $14,994 |
